黑料社鈥檚 黑料社 Chorus will present their fall concert, titled Walk Together, on Saturday, Nov. 18 at 6:30 p.m. in the Gault Recital Hall of Scheide Music Center (525 E. University Street).听

Under the direction of Lisa Wong, Olive Williams Kettering Professor of Music, the 黑料社 Chorus will present an eclectic program of contemporary choral music. The concert will include the work of American composers Elaine Hagenberg, B.E. Boykin, and Eric Whitacre. At the heart of the program, the chorus will feature Jake Runestad鈥檚 鈥淚 Was Love,鈥 which recently was performed in honor of President Anne E. McCall鈥檚 inauguration.

In addition to directing the 黑料社 Chorus, Wong is a co-chair of the Department of Music and teaches courses in conducting, choral literature, and music education. She also serves as Director of Choruses for the Cleveland Orchestra. Wong has a bachelor鈥檚 degree in music education from West Chester University, and a master鈥檚 and doctorate degree in choral conducting from Indiana University.听

Founded in 1964, the 黑料社 Chorus is comprised of students representing all academic areas within 黑料社鈥檚 liberal arts program. The award-winning ensemble has been praised for its beautiful sound, high level of artistry, creative programming, and engaging performances.听 The Chorus collaborates annually with The Cleveland Orchestra and Cleveland Orchestra Chorus and has premiered an array of works by American composers. The ensemble has performed at the Central Division conference of the American Choral Directors Association, and several times at the state conference of the Ohio Music Education Association.听
